Is it sacrilegious to play with your iPod or Blackberry during church? Not after this week. Reuters reports that "an assembly of Catholic bishops on Monday called for the use of mass communications -- including television, cinema, DVDs and even iPods -- to be used to spread the Bible in as many languages as possible."

Don't let the robes and pomp fool you.  When it comes to adopting new technologies, The Vatican has always been accepting. One of Europe's first websites came from the Catholic church.

"The voice of the Divine Word must resonate over the radio, on Internet channels with virtual distribution (and by) CDs, DVDs and iPods, and on television and cinema screens," an official statement said.
